An estimation of the adhesive, tiles and grout needed for the tiling should be completed before any actual tiling work commences. This is known as "setting out" in the world of tilers and should be accomplished even before the areas to be tiled are prepared. The costs involved in your project can then be easily worked out by your tiling specialist. Maintaining a tight reign on your spending is important with every home improvement project.

In preparing the surface for the new tiling all existing tiles, paint or other decorative elements should be removed except in cases where they do not affect the new tiling. It may well be the case that your surface areas require repairing and smoothing with cement or plaster to ensure a good level finish for the tile adhesive to bond to. All edges will have to be examined with regards to their angles against one other; even a small degree from true can cause visual irregularities in the lines of your tiling.

Any floor coverings in place have to be lifted before tiling can begin. If the bathroom floor is already fitted with tiles, these will need to be prised up and any remnants of adhesive got rid off. Any skirting boards will also need to be removed or lifted, and any waste disposed of correctly. At this point your tilers will evaluate the condition of your floor surfaces and, if required, apply a self-levelling screed to provide a solid sub-base for your new tiles.

It is entirely possible to perform a DIY installation, but with the chance of errors costing a lot of money to resolve, it is easier, and normally cheaper in the long run to employ a professional tiler to install your new floor tiles.

Now that you have the project completely planned, and the tile chosen, it is time to start the actual work. Prior to you add that first tile, make sure that the surface is correctly prepared or you will run into issues later on down the road. Each of the areas to be tiled must be prepared properly. Regardless of what area you will tile, it needs to be even, smooth with no rough edges, and it needs to be water proofed or primed. You must make sure that your surface area is well prepared to ensure that tiling will go smoothly. This is surely the most crucial element of doing the job right. Unless you prepare the surface properly, you will probably fail in your tiling project and you will have one big mess.

Once the ground work is all done, it is time for putting down the tile. You will quickly realize that laying ceramic tile is not that hard. It can be a messy task, for that reason make preparations to seal off the rest of the house. Definitely wear security glasses when you're cutting floor tile and check that the surface to be tiled is very clean. If you have performed your surface preparation the right way, you will find that applying adhesive and placing the tile is going to be quite easy. You will need a level and a spacer if you want to make sure that the tiles are uniformly spaced. Once the adhesive has solidified, then it is time for the finishing touches.

To be able to finish up with the grout, you spread it on with a rubber trowel, and then wipe it off with a cotton cloth. Try to make sure that all the cracks have been filled with grout and you are pretty much done.
